uzzyfire:
wat is jos seasons ? wat time of d year does it get extremely cold and very hot
November to early March, it gets very cold, while december and January are almost freezing.
No matter how hot Jos is, it hardly exceeds 32°.

All year round, night time and early morn temperatures in Jos must drop below 19°.
See this week's forecast for Jos below... ...Surprisingly, Port harcourt is sometimes even cooler than Jos during the rainy seasons.

forgiveness:
That's cool. So, what are works on ground?
The satelite town development agency (STDA) of Abuja was created specially for the development of Abuja satelite towns.
There has been a lot of construction and renovation of roads linking and within the satelite towns. Estate developers are being given plots in satelite towns and forced to develop them by the govt, and you won't believe the beautiful, standard and comparatively cheaper estates being built in some Abuja satelite towns.
Niger and Nasarawa state govts must put their hands together with FCTA in this, because many Abuja satelite towns have developed into Nasarawa and Niger states. Nasarawa state governor is trying here but Niger state governor is something else.
